Step Four: Bring on the Barbecue

Fire up the grill and throw on some chicken teriyaki pineapple skewers, chipotle mango-seasoned mahi-mahi, or Hawaiian pulled pork. Pay homage to Puerto Rico, the home of the Piña Colada, with ground beef-stuffed empanadillas or mofongo, a fried plantain dish. A spread of fresh fruit helps keep guests quenched as the party lingers long into the night.

Step Five: Shake Up the RumChata Colada

And now for the hero of the event, the RumChata Colada. This one-two punch of vibrant pineapple flavor and smooth coconut rum is all you need to pretend you’re enjoying an afternoon under a cove of palm trees, with the ocean and your closest friends nearby.

Ingredients:

  • 1 ½ ounces RumChata Pineapple Cream
  • 1 ½ ounces coconut rum (RumHaven recommended)

Instructions:

  1. Add RumChata Pineapple Cream and RumHaven Coconut Rum into an ice-filled shaker.
  2. Shake to combine and chill.
  3. Strain into a glass and garnish with a juicy slice of pineapple.
